The size of North Adelaide is approximately 5.1 square kilometres. It has 40 parks covering nearly 57.8% of total area. The population of North Adelaide in 2016 was 6950 people. By 2021 the population was 6823 showing a population decline of 1.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in North Adelaide is 20-29 years. Households in North Adelaide are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in North Adelaide work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 50.60% of the homes in North Adelaide were owner-occupied compared with 48.80% in 2016.
